:OSNews: Editorial: The Advent of Longhorn and OSS Considerations
OSNews: Editorial: The Advent of Longhorn and OSS Considerations
Apr 21, 2004, 01 :45 UTC (24 Talkback[s]) (10467 reads)

(Other stories by Phil Crosby)

"Longhorn's arrival will indeed be monumental, as their research teams are finally producing something worthwhile. The OSS world has much to do in preparation for this release; this version of Microsoft's OS will not simply offer trivial UI 'enhancements' that appeal to users, as it has done in the past--they are really targeting both users and developers very forcefully this time around.

"I interned there last summer and got to see and use Longhorn, and saw the beta-Longhorn technologies (including the amazing Avalon, as well as a super alpha XAML (pronounced 'zamel' implementation). The developers were excited, as they should be..."
